Fire Debris & Structure Removal

Darco Engineering offers comprehensive fire debris removal services, including on-site evaluations and the safe removal of hazardous materials, to help you rebuild swiftly.

With extensive experience in both residential and commercial sectors, Darco specializes in removing fire debris, which often contains hazardous materials like ash, lead, and asbestos. We adhere to stringent safety regulations to guarantee efficient and compliant disposal.

  • On-Site Evaluation: We begin with a comprehensive assessment to gauge the extent of the damage.
  • Licensed Hazardous Cleanup: Darco holds the Hazardous Substances Removal (HAZ) Certification and has formed a strategic partnership with an environmental corporation to provide comprehensive asbestos and lead abatement services.  No matter what hazardous waste is encountered, we are licensed and have the skills to dispose of it safely and properly.
  • Comprehensive Removal: Equipped to take down complex structures, remove foundations, hardscape, footings, pools, basements and clear trees.
  • Second Pass – Post ACE Site Clearing: The Army Corps of Engineers will not remove certain items (e.g., driveways, pools, basements, retaining walls, fences, trees, and pavement outside the ash footprint). We are ready and able to remove those items in the second pass.
